Output 7fdf0655b63fa3e66d7a934aa129b8ec30f9d66155c85543fea5541ade0fbfb8:0

value
23915053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e8bfe9887ff9f1ca081b272d068ef86e452b43 OP_EQUAL
address
3CSToiaGiL3WvcLzuuTvHsKZw57S9Zpfbv
transaction
7fdf0655b63fa3e66d7a934aa129b8ec30f9d66155c85543fea5541ade0fbfb8
spent
true